xAI gets permits for 15 natural gas generators at Memphis data center

County regulators yesterday granted xAI permits to operate 15 natural gas turbines at its data center outside Memphis, despite the threat of a lawsuit. Google’s data center energy use doubled in 4 years

No wonder Google is desperate for more power: The company’s data centers more than doubled their electricity use in just four years. The eye-popping stat comes from Google’s most recent sustainability report, which it released late last week. In 2024, Google data centers used 30.8 million megawatt-hours of electricity. Breakneck data center growth challenges Microsoft’s sustainability goals

Microsoft’s new sustainability report, released late last week, shows how a carbon-heavy economy can weigh on a company that wants to be carbon light.
